UA signee Wallace arrested

- MATT JONES WHOLEHOGSP­ORTS.COM

FAYETTEVIL­LE — Catrell Wallace, a Bryant High School student who in December signed to play football at the University of Arkansas, was arrested Monday in Benton.

Wallace, 18, was arrested in connection with second-degree sexual assault, a Class B felony, and tampering, a Class D felony, according to his detention profile on the Saline County sheriff’s office website.

He was booked into the county jail at 8:46 a.m. Monday and released at 2:42 p.m. Jail records did not list a bond amount.

Krista Petty with the Benton Police Department said in an email Monday that Wallace’s arrest report was unavailabl­e because the investigat­ion was ongoing, “and we do not release incident reports in those instances.”

According to a news release from the Benton Police Department, Wallace turned himself in Monday after an arrest warrant had been issued.

Police said the incident under investigat­ion occurred on Jan. 1 when Wallace was 18 and the victim was 12.

“Although it appears to have been a consensual encounter, BNPD detectives were able to determine that Wallace had reason to believe the victim was underage at the time of the crime,” police wrote in a statement. “It was also noted that Wallace instructed witnesses to lie about the crime in an effort to conceal it.”

Police said additional charges could be forthcomin­g.

In a statement released through the UA athletics media relations department, Razorbacks football coach Sam Pittman said he was “aware of the serious allegation­s” involving Wallace.

“We are gathering informatio­n and [are] in contact with the proper authoritie­s regarding the situation,” Pittman said. “Once we have additional informatio­n, we will make a determinat­ion on his status with our program.”

As a defensive end and linebacker, Wallace recorded 60 tackles — including a sack and six others for loss — broke up four passes and blocked four punts as a senior on Bryant’s Class 7A state championsh­ip team. He is also a member of the school’s basketball team.
